Graff Taps BTS Star Jung Kook as New Face of the Brand

Luxury jeweler Graff has announced a new partnership with Jung Kook, the global superstar and member of K-pop sensation BTS, appointing him as its latest global ambassador. The campaign, launched on Thursday, showcases Jung Kook wearing pieces from the Laurence Graff line, which reinterprets the founder's passion for exceptional diamonds through faceted precious metal links.

François Graff, CEO of the jewelry house, praised Jung Kook as a cultural icon whose bold and refined artistry aligns perfectly with Graff's commitment to pushing boundaries in high jewelry. He stated, "Jung Kook is a cultural icon, recognized for his multi-faceted talent. Bold and refined, he always offers remarkable performances. Just like Graff, which strives to push the boundaries of high jewelry, [he] explores and constantly surpasses those of his creativity."

Jung Kook, known for his powerful vocals and dynamic stage presence, expressed deep gratitude for the role, calling it a "profound honor" to represent a house that has created many legends over the decades. He has been a prominent figure in the music industry since BTS debuted in 2013, contributing to the group's record-breaking success and global recognition.

Jung Kook's Rising Influence in Luxury

This announcement marks another milestone in Jung Kook's expanding presence in the luxury sector. Earlier this year, he was named an ambassador for Swiss watchmaker Hublot, further solidifying his status as a sought-after brand partner. His appeal stems not only from his immense popularity — with millions of fans worldwide — but also from his authentic connection to artistic excellence.

BTS, the septet comprising RM, Jin, Suga, J-Hope, Jimin, V, and Jung Kook, is currently on the European leg of their global tour for their album "Arirang," with upcoming concerts in Belgium, London, Germany, and Paris. The tour has been a massive success, drawing sold-out crowds and demonstrating the group's enduring appeal.

Jung Kook's role as Graff ambassador is expected to introduce the brand to a younger, more diverse audience, particularly in Asia and among K-pop fans. Graff, known for its high-end jewelry and watch collections, has previously collaborated with celebrities like Naomi Campbell and athletes, but this partnership signals a strategic move toward pop culture and music.

The Graff Legacy and the Campaign

Founded by Laurence Graff in 1960, the jeweler has become synonymous with extraordinary diamonds and craftsmanship. The Laurence Graff line, featured in the campaign, is a tribute to the founder's expertise in sourcing and cutting rare stones. The designs incorporate bold, sculptural links that emulate the facets of a diamond, blending modern aesthetics with classic elegance.

The campaign imagery captures Jung Kook wearing these statement pieces, emphasizing their versatility and contemporary edge. The photoshoot, rumored to have taken place in London, highlights the synergy between the artist's dynamic energy and Graff's sophisticated designs.
